I used Maya Road's Clear Acrylic Calendar Stand w/ chipboard pages to help me create this project. Basically the acrylic stand is used to hold up the snowman and a little felt pocket (in the back) that holds the extra chipboard pages. Since the stand comes with 6 pages I numbered both sides of the chipboard to get a 12 day countdown. To apply the hooks just screw them though the front of chipboard body, then line up the screws ends to the acrylic stand's pre-drilled holes. Use washers to secure the ends. Tip: I didn't have washers, so I used Wood Bingo Numbers at the back of the screws instead. They were the perfect size and kept the end of the screw concealed.
For the body of the snowman I used one of the Birdcage Book pages and then cut the head and hat out of 2 layers of raw chipboard.
Yummy Maya Glitter was applied to the Philadephia Chipboard Numbers and Mini Snowflakes.
In this close up you can see how I embellished the snowman with some of MR's new trims. My favorite trim and favorite part of the snowman has to be his mouth. I just spritzed a 2 inch piece of the Bubble Dot - Crochet Trim with Brown Mist, let it dry and then glued it in place.
